Handover: remind-job for Larkspur Clinic Suite. Cron fires hourly; job pulls tomorrow's appointments from apptdb, dedupes, pushes SMS via the Quillgate relay. Retries: 3, then dead-letter. Watch the timezone column — it's clinic-local, not UTC. Config lives in /etc/larkspur/remind.yml. Logs rotate weekly. If the relay token expires, re-enroll with the vault tool on the ops box; Dana left it set up. Unlocking the vault requires the recovery passphrase below.

vault phrase of fahog-yajof = istael-zorwyn

Runbook — Harrowfield telemetry gateway, account recovery. If the gateway's uplink account is locked (three bad auth attempts from a combine unit), field data buffers locally for 12 hours max. Recover before the buffer fills. SSH to the gateway, run the recovery tool, select the uplink account, and supply the passphrase below.

unlock words, yawig-kagef: gordor-holvan-ulaael-pramir-ulaiel-tamdor

**Q: Why are ticket prices different for some of my plugin's users?**

A: Short version: the Stagefront team is running a pricing experiment on the Merrow events platform. Roughly 15% of buyers see adjusted fees, which your plugin receives via the usual `price` field — no code changes needed, but don't cache prices longer than five minutes during the trial. It wraps up at the end of the quarter. Questions or weird edge cases can go to the address below.

escalation mailbox, hadug-bajog: sormir@norvalabs.internal

Handover for the security review of Lunebook's date localization work. Tomas, I've moved all date formatting to the shared locale service so raw user locale strings never reach the renderer unescaped — that was the injection vector flagged last quarter. Timezone offsets are now validated against an allowlist, and the legacy format-string path is behind a kill switch. Please pay close attention to the fallback parser. The threat notes and test matrix are on the internal page here.

runbook for tajep-yahig: https://artifactory.lumictech.corp/repo